Introduction to University Programs
The University of Barcelona's Institute of Continuing Education offers a wide range of programs in various fields, including health and social sciences, pharmacy, business and sustainability, education and culture, and physical activity and sports sciences.
Program Details
- Màster en Tecnologia de l'Esport: This master's program is offered online and consists of 60 ECTS credits.
- Màster en Sistemes Complexos en l'Esport: This master's program is also offered online and consists of 60 ECTS credits.
